of a lesser priority
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
"of a lesser priority" is correct and can be used in written English.
It implies that something is not the most important thing to focus on or maintain. For example: "Getting a perfect grade on the test is important, but staying healthy is of a lesser priority."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When using "of a lesser priority", ensure the context clearly establishes what the higher priority is. This provides a clear comparison and avoids ambiguity.
Common error
Avoid using "of a lesser priority" when the item is truly unimportant or irrelevant. This phrase implies some level of importance, just not the highest.

FAQs
How can I use "of a lesser priority" in a sentence?
Use "of a lesser priority" to indicate that something is less important than something else. For example, "While finishing the report is crucial, responding to emails is "of a lesser priority" right now."
What is a synonym for "of a lesser priority"?
Alternatives include "less important", "lower in precedence", or "secondary consideration", depending on the specific context.
Is it correct to say "of lower priority" instead of "of a lesser priority"?
Yes, "of lower priority" is a grammatically sound and frequently used alternative. Both phrases effectively convey the same meaning, indicating reduced importance.
When should I use "of a lesser priority" versus "not a priority"?
"Of a lesser priority" implies that something is still important but not as urgent or significant as something else. "Not a priority" indicates that something is currently unimportant or will be addressed later, if at all.
